#f7e298 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7e298 is composed of 96.9% red, 88.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 46.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 78.2%. #f7e298 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#efc531.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#f7e298 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7e298 has RGB values of R:247, G:226,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.38,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16245400.

Shades and Tints of #f7e298
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060500 is the darkest color, while #fefc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7e298
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c8c7 is the less saturated color, while #fbe494 is the most saturated one.
